With that, Cebit. BenQ. New phones. Award winning phones at that. The BenQ CL71 with IPS and wide-angle viewing functions, product design award winner.
The BenQ CL71 is a new slider with a semi-automatic slide function, 24MB internal memory expandable with micro SD card slot, Bluetooth, MP3 player, FM radio, 1.3 megapixel camera with 3x zoom and multishot function.

The BenQ E61 music mobile, 6 band equalizer, expandable memory with mini SD card (up to 1GB), camera with 2x/4x digital zoom.
The BenQ E61 will be available in both silver and black w/ orange.
The BenQ CF61 (clamshell) 1.3 megapixel camera with multishot function and 4x digital zoom, interchangeable covers, media player supporting MP3, AAC or WMA, Java games.
This CF61 model is very similar to the E61 expandable to 1GB with micro SD cards as well.
BenQ Mobile through the offering announced at CeBit 2006 is showing an awareness and understanding of the depth and range needed to attract mobile consumers.
They showed a good mix in both mobile phone features and functions, this combined with award winning designs should attract users at all price points.

Pricing is not available at this time. All phones are expected to be released sometime this year.
